Yes if you are from the EU, the EEA Migrant Worker team assess students who do not meet the required standard core eligibility requirements but the student or their EU/EEA family member are working in the UK.

The application you should complete will be a PN1, the same as a home student.
Paper application should be posted to;
EU Migrant Worker Team Student Finance England PO Box 89 Darlington DL1 9AZ

To be assessed as Child of a migrant worker, your parent must be working and remain working throughout your studies.

We can only accept original documents, your original EU Identity Card will be acceptable.
